Design of optimized tread profile for high-speed EMUs
To address two significant issues in high-speed electric multiple units (EMU), i.e. degraded vehicle dynamic performance under existing wheel-rail interactions and increased wheel tread wear at elevated operating speeds, this paper proposes an optimized tread profile design that balances wheel-rail interactions, dynamic performance, and wear resistance.

Improving fatigue resistance of translucent 4Y‐PSZ zirconia through glass gradation
Abstract To evaluate the effect of graded glass infiltration on the fatigue behavior and mechanical reliability of translucent 4Y‐PSZ zirconia before and after hydrothermal aging, disc‐shaped specimens were fabricated by uniaxial pressing and divided into control and glass‐graded groups (n = 36/group).
